The Arizona Department of Transportation (ADOT) advises motorists to plan for ramp closures and lane restrictions on east- and westbound Interstate 10 in the Broadway Curve while bridge work is underway.

Eastbound I-10 will be narrowed to two lanes between 40th Street and Broadway Road nightly from 8 p.m. to 4 a.m. now through the morning of Thursday, July 21. 

At the same time, westbound I-10 will be narrowed to two lanes between Broadway Road and 48th Street. 

The following ramps will also be closed: 

  • The westbound US 60 high-occupancy vehicle (HOV) ramp to westbound I-10.

  • The southbound State Route 143 loop ramp to eastbound I-10. Drivers should continue south onto 48th Street and use the eastbound I-10 on-ramp at Broadway Road.  

  • The eastbound I-10 on-ramps at 40th Street. Drivers can use the eastbound I-10 on-ramp at Broadway Road instead.

ADOT advises drivers to slow down and use caution around construction personnel and equipment while work is underway.
